PHP ignore_user_abort() 函数
定义和用法
ignore_user_abort()
函数设置与客户机断开是否会终止脚本的执行。
本函数返回 user-abort 设置的之前的值(一个布尔值)。
提示:PHP 不会检测到用户是否已断开连接,直到尝试向客户机发送信息为止。简单地使用 echo 语句无法确保信息发送,参阅 flush() 函数。
实例
设置为 false(默认)- 客户端中止将导致脚本停止运行:
<?php ignore_user_abort(); ?>
输出:
0
语法
ignore_user_abort(setting)
参数 | 描述 |
---|---|
setting |
可选。如果设置为 TRUE,则在脚本中忽略用户中止(脚本将继续运行)。 默认为 FALSE,意味着客户端中止将导致脚本停止运行。 |
技术细节
返回值: | 以整型返回之前的设置。 |
---|---|
PHP 版本: | 4+ |